Bay Area Market ... Pre-Foreclosures in Palo Alto, California - 12/29/10 01:02 PM
I recently wrote about pre-foreclosures - distressed properties for which the owner has been notified by their lender that they are late on their mortgage payments.  Although these properties are not always listed for sale, it's possible to initiate a sale and potentially help the current owner out of a tight spot.  Many owners won't list their property for sale because they don't want the embarrassment of a For Sale sign in their yard or they don't think they can get the price they want.  Some see foreclosure as unavoidable and a short sale as a long, painful and fruitless process.  … (0 comments)

Pre-Foreclosures Are Not Always For Sale... But Might Be - 12/28/10 12:42 PM
Buyers, I hear you.  Several calls and emails each week from buyers of family homes and investment properties saying - "show us foreclosures and short sale properties, we want a deal!"
Many of you are also asking to look at pre-foreclosure properties.  But a common misconception is that these properties, also called distressed properties or NOD's (Notice of Default), are always for sale.  We get visibility to the fact that the current owner is behind on their mortgage when the lender files a Notice of Default with the county recorder's office, which makes the notice a public document.  There are dozens … (0 comments)
